A Self Managed Super Fund (SMSF) allows you to take control of your superannuation and invest in property or other asset classes that you prefer, understand and control.
Today SMSF’s are the fastest growing segment of the superannuation industry. There are over 400,000 SMSF’s managed by everyday Australians just like you. DIY super is no longer the exclusive province of the wealthy. The costs of setting up and managing your own fund have been driven down by the popularity of this perfectly normal approach to taking responsibility for your financial future.

The main advantages of purchasing property within your SMSF are:
- Choice of commercial or residential property
- You have control over your investment
- Own property with zero affect on your cash flow
- Own additional property without paying land tax
- Reduce tax on rental income to only 15%
- Only pay 10% capital gains tax if held for 12 months
- NO capital gains tax if the property is sold after retirement.
